Output 310592431a24ad084957c3203b296b7611ee25d5181c08664c6da384a6e9af68:2

value
28985
script pubkey
OP_0 OP_PUSHBYTES_20 c76a415e51140d12bb5c015a0cb8eae46649375b
address
bc1qca4yzhj3zsx39w6uq9dqew82u3nyjd6musnrjd
transaction
310592431a24ad084957c3203b296b7611ee25d5181c08664c6da384a6e9af68
spent
true